Description

The Darrell Almond Community Park offers the community of Norwood a beautifully maintained park. Recently, LED lights were added to the trail to offer a layer of safety and comfort for the residents wanting to walk in the early or later hours. The other hours are spent watching or playing baseball, volleyball or disc golf. The Darrell Almond Community Park Trail runs along a large lake that hosts plenty of turtles, fish and ducks to the delight of all the kids enjoying the playground.
